msuspartans.com —  Michigan State triple jumper Tori Franklin has been named the Big Ten Co-Field Track Athlete Of The Week, as announced by the conference office this afternoon. Franklin set a indoor school record this past weekend at the Spire Invitiational while winning the triple jump with an effort of 13.05m (42-9 ¾). read more »

msuspartans.com —  Tori Franklin, a freshman from Westmont, Ill., is now the school record holder in the indoor triple jump as confirmed this morning. Her jump of 13.05m (42-9 ¾) topped Sherita Williams' record of 13.04m (42-9 ½) which was set in 2004. read more »
